Subdomain II of α-Isopropylmalate Synthase Is Essential for Activity: INFERRING A MECHANISM OF FEEDBACK INHIBITION
The committed step of leucine biosynthesis, converting acetyl-CoA and α-ketoisovalerate into α-isopropylmalate, is catalyzed by α-isopropylmalate synthase (IPMS), an allosteric enzyme subjected to feedback inhibition by the end product l-leucine.
